SANTA ANA : Neat Robber Litters Freeway With Loot
A robber wearing a neatly pressed suit and a red tie held up a bank Thursday and then apparently threw part of the loot out of his car along the Costa Mesa Freeway, police said.
Police spokeswoman Maureen Haacker said the man was in his mid-40s, with a salt-and-pepper beard. He walked into the Bank of America branch at 2127 E. 17th St. and demanded money, saying he had a gun, Haacker said.
Although no one could describe the car, police were told that the man drove from the bank toward the freeway, where officers later found a bank bag filled with money.
